prezoom wrote:I had a 1995 Nissan 300ZX Turbo with a pre World Class T5. It shifted like crap, and you almost had to double clutch to keep from beating the syncros. I hope someone with a WC version will chime in on their experiences.
I have a TVR Cerbera with a WC T5 in it. In my opinion, the T5 is really crap. Shifting is bad (especially reverse and 5th) it is noisy and prone to fail (OK, the gearbox is at its limits in a Cerbera).
My old Aston from the 70ies had a 5-speed ZF, this was precise, smooth an quick to shift. But hey, what shall I moan, there are not many options left to convert our Elan's for modern traffic. Go for it
